Parents may be aware of Elboya’s overflow designation due to capacity.  This new process has been a learning curve.  Many families have been directed to our overflow sites Chinook Park (elementary) & Woodman (jr. high) when certain grades at Elboya reached capacity.  Contrarily, we are also experiencing families that are moving out of our area so we are looking carefully at enrollment on a daily basis and have begun the “call back” process to bring back students that were originally sent to one of our overflow schools.  Balancing our classes whilst ensuring our numbers are healthy is tricky!

Terry Fox (All Grades) On Friday, September 15th, Elboya School is hosting our annual Terry Fox day and run! We will start with different activities highlighting Terry’s impacts, followed by an assembly and neighborhood run.  This day will be a celebration of why your child runs for Terry.  Please ensure your student is dressed for the weather, wears sunscreen and has a water bottle. Students should come to school in comfortable clothes and wear their house colours!

 

We are continuing to fundraise for the Terry Fox foundation and cancer research until Friday September 22nd. Fundraising for the Terry Fox foundation will take place on-line at the following link https://schools.terryfox.ca/Elboya
